Welcome to Hotel The Augustin in the heart of Brussels, Belgium! Our 4-star hotel is located on Avenue Stalingrad, just 1 kilometer from the bustling city center. With 3368 reviews, you can trust that your stay with us will be a memorable one.

Start your day with a delicious breakfast spread at our hotel before heading out to explore the city. Our pet-friendly accommodations ensure that your furry friends can join in on the fun too (extra charges may apply). Enjoy free WiFi throughout the hotel and take advantage of our shuttle service and airport pickup (extra charges may apply) for hassle-free transportation.

Our hotel offers a range of room types to suit every traveler's needs. Whether you're traveling with family or friends, our Classic Quadruple Room is the perfect choice. With two queen-size beds, it can accommodate up to four adults and three children comfortably. For a more luxurious stay, our Deluxe Double Room features a spacious king-size bed, ideal for couples or individuals. And if you're looking for a flexible option, our Classic Double or Twin Room offers the choice of either two twin beds or a queen-size bed, accommodating two adults and one child.

I was a bit skeptical as the hotel room size look small in picture, apparently that is not the case. We had 4 big size luggage and place is still roomy to lay out all 4. Room is with bathtub with good water pressure, the amenities were l'occitane so the smell was super good. We had a good room in first floor corner so had a good view to the street and can people watch. Bed size is sufficient and very comfortable. The reception (a guy with long hair) was very nice, as well as the breakfast lady who offered to fill our children's water bottle. There was also a gym with all complete equipment and my son loved to spend time there, as it opens 24hr.

A wonderful, safe, quiet hotel for a family of four. The location was perfect, a walk from the train station and to the city center. There were black out curtains covering nice big windows that could be opened wide for fresh air. The reception staff were so kind, helpful and amazing. Even loaning us a HDMI cable so we could watch the Euro Final in our room. Really helpful with directions and looking up information as we needed. We really appreciated the receptionist from Venezuela, he went above and beyond to help us.

Fantastic location, central for everything, we flew into Charleroi airport, bus to bruxelles midi, then it was only a short walk to the hotel. Metro stations close by for exploring further and only a short walk drom The Grand Place! The hotel staff were all lovely, very helpful and informative! Bed was really comfortable and breakfast was great too. The hotel was quiet due to it bein February, there were renovation happening in the hotel but it didn't cause us any issues

Our room (401) including the en-suite was spacious and clean, the latter had a bath which was a plus. The beds were comfortable and the staff were helpful and welcoming. Breakfast was good with a wide selection although the hot item choices was limited and there was no cut fruit salad. For us the location was good being close to eateries, the Eurostar train & Metro station and some of the attractions, in particular the Grand Place.
